掌握PHP、Java和C++,成为全栈开发专家</p><p>在当今这个快速发展的互联网时代,技术人才的需求越来越大,掌握一门或多门编程语言已经成为了程序员的基本技能,而在这三门编程语言中,PHP、Java和C++是最受欢迎的编程语言之一,如何才能成为一名全栈开发专家呢?本文将从PHP、Java和C++的基本知识入手,为你提供一些建议和指导。</p><p>1、PHP基础</p><p>PHP是一种开源的通用脚本语言,主要用于Web开发,它可以嵌入到HTML中,也可以用作命令行脚本处理大量任务,要掌握PHP,你需要了解以下几个方面:</p><p>- PHP基本语法:变量、数据类型、运算符、控制结构等;</p><p>- PHP函数:字符串处理、数组操作、时间日期处理等;</p><p>- PHP面向对象编程:类与对象、继承、封装、多态等;</p><p>- PHP常用扩展:MySQL、GD库、JSON等;</p><p>- PHP框架:Laravel、Yii等。</p><p>2、Java基础</p><p>Java是一种面向对象的编程语言,具有跨平台、安全、稳定等特点,要掌握Java,你需要了解以下几个方面:</p><p>- Java基本语法:变量、数据类型、运算符、控制结构等;</p><p>- Java面向对象编程:类与对象、继承、封装、多态等;</p><p>- Java集合框架:List、Set、Map等;</p><p>- Java异常处理:try-catch-finally等;</p><p>- Java I/O流:文件操作、网络编程等;</p><p>- Java多线程编程:线程创建、同步、锁等;</p><p>- Java虚拟机(JVM):内存模型、垃圾回收机制等;</p><p>- Java常用框架:Spring、MyBatis等。</p><p>3、C++基础</p><p>C++是一种通用的编程语言,具有高效、灵活等特点,要掌握C++,你需要了解以下几个方面:</p><p>- C++基本语法:变量、数据类型、运算符、控制结构等;</p><p>- C++面向对象编程:类与对象、继承、封装、多态等;</p><p>- C++标准模板库(STL):容器、迭代器、算法等;</p><p>- C++异常处理:try-catch-finally等;</p><p>- C++输入输出流:文件操作、网络编程等;</p><p>- C++多线程编程:线程创建、同步、锁等;</p><p>- C++内存管理:动态内存分配、智能指针等;</p><p>- C++常用框架:Qt、Boost等。</p><p>4、全栈开发技能</p><p>掌握了以上三门编程语言的基本知识后,你就可以开始学习全栈开发技能了,全栈开发者需要具备以下能力:</p><p>- 前端技术:HTML5、CSS3、JavaScript、前端框架(如React、Vue等);</p><p>- 后端技术:熟悉至少一种后端语言(如PHP、Java或Python),并掌握相应的框架(如Laravel、Spring Boot或Django);</p><p>- 数据库技术:熟悉关系型数据库(如MySQL)和非关系型数据库(如MongoDB);</p><p>- 网络技术:了解HTTP协议、RESTful API设计规范等;</p><p>- 版本控制工具:如Git;</p><p>- 项目管理工具:如GitHub、GitLab等。</p><p>5、实践项目经验</p><p>要想成为一名全栈开发专家,实践经验至关重要,你可以参与一些实际项目的开发,或者自己动手实现一些小项目,通过实践,你可以更好地理解和掌握所学的知识,同时也能积累宝贵的项目经验。</p><p>要想成为一名全栈开发专家,你需要从基础知识入手,逐步掌握各种编程语言和技能,不断实践和积累项目经验也是非常重要的,只要你坚持不懈地学习和努力,相信你一定能成为一名优秀的全栈开发专家!
正文
文章内容价值,文章内容价值高获得两次收藏是指哪里收藏
文章最后更新时间2024年11月10日,若文章内容或图片失效,请留言反馈!
除非注明,否则均为后台设置版权信息原创文章,转载或复制请以超链接形式并注明出处。
还没有评论,来说两句吧...